Understanding the Critical Role of Water Leak Sensors in Apartment Complexes

Water damage is one of the most persistent, destructive, and expensive liabilities facing modern residential properties, especially multi-family complexes, high-rise apartments, and condominium buildings. Unlike single-family homes, a leak on the top floor of an apartment building does not remain localized. Gravity ensures that water migrates downward, seeping through concrete slabs, tracking along electrical conduits, ruining drywall, and destroying personal belongings across multiple units underneath. The financial fallout from a single undetected leak can easily reach tens of thousands of dollars in property damage, temporary tenant relocation costs, mold remediation, and skyrocketing insurance premiums.

The Evolution of Residential Leak Detection: From Localized Buzzers to Connected IoT Ecosystems

Historically, water leak detection was limited to simple battery-powered buzzers placed under kitchen sinks or near water heaters. While effective if someone was home to hear the alarm, these devices were useless in vacant units, during working hours, or when tenants were traveling. If a pipe burst in an empty apartment, the leak would often go unnoticed until water began dripping through the ceiling of the unit below.

Today, the integration of Internet of Things (IoT) technologies has revolutionized residential security and damage prevention. Modern water leak sensors for apartments utilize advanced wireless communication protocols such as Wi-Fi, Zigbee, and LoRaWAN to provide real-time alerts. When moisture is detected, the sensor immediately transmits a signal to a cloud server, which sends instant push notifications, SMS alerts, or emails to both the resident and the property management team. This allows for immediate intervention, minimizing damage from hours to minutes.

Key Industrial & Commercial Trends in Residential Water Management

The PropTech (Property Technology) market is experiencing rapid growth, driven by the demand for smarter, safer, and more sustainable buildings. Several key trends are shaping the deployment of water leak sensors in apartments and residential properties:

  • Insurance Mandates and Premium Discounts: Insurance providers are increasingly requiring property owners to install connected leak detection systems as a condition of coverage, or offering substantial premium discounts (often 10% to 25%) to buildings that proactively deploy these systems.
  • Integration with Smart Valves: Advanced systems do not just alert stakeholders; they take action. Integrating wireless water sensors with automated main shut-off valves allows the system to automatically cut off the water supply to a unit the moment a leak is detected, completely neutralizing the threat.
  • Unified Property Management Platforms: Modern property managers prefer consolidated dashboards. Leak sensors are now integrated directly into property management software (like Yardi, RealPage, or custom IoT hubs), allowing maintenance crews to track the health of hundreds of units from a single screen.
  • Battery Longevity and Low-Power Protocols: Utilizing Zigbee or sub-GHz wireless channels ensures that sensors can run on standard lithium batteries for 3 to 5 years, reducing the maintenance overhead of battery replacement cycles for large property portfolios.

Deep Dive: Critical Installation Scenarios in Multi-Family Properties

To maximize the effectiveness of a residential water leak detection network, sensors must be strategically placed in high-risk zones. Understanding these micro-environments allows developers and property managers to deploy sensors where they will deliver the fastest response times.

1. Under-Sink and Appliance Monitoring

Kitchen sinks, bathroom vanities, washing machines, and dishwashers are the most common sources of slow, hidden leaks. Over time, loose fittings, cracked hoses, or failing seals can drip water behind cabinetry, leading to wood rot and hazardous mold growth before the tenant even notices. 2. HVAC Condensate Drain Pans

In hot and humid climates, apartment air conditioning units work constantly. If the condensate drain line becomes clogged with algae or debris, the overflow pan quickly fills and spills over. Since HVAC units in apartments are often located in utility closets above living spaces, an overflow can quickly ruin ceilings and floors. A water sensor placed directly in the auxiliary drain pan detects water accumulation instantly and can even be wired to shut down the AC unit to prevent further condensation.

3. Water Heaters and Boiler Rooms

Residential water heaters have a finite lifespan, typically failing after 8 to 12 years. When a tank ruptures, it can release hundreds of gallons of hot water in a matter of minutes. Placing a sensor in the safety pan beneath the water heater is one of the highest-yielding risk reduction strategies a property owner can implement.

4. Main Water Risers and Utility Shafts

In multi-story residential buildings, main water lines run vertically through utility shafts. A joint failure in one of these shafts can cause catastrophic damage across dozens of floors. Placing specialized rope sensors or spot detectors at the base of these shafts provides early warning of structural plumbing failures.

How Smart Sensors Protect Vacant Units and Tenant Turnover

Tenant turnover periods are high-risk windows for property owners. When an apartment sits empty during renovations or between leases, there is no occupant to notice a dripping faucet or a running toilet. A running toilet can waste thousands of gallons of water daily, drastically inflating utility bills in master-metered buildings. More critically, a sudden pipe burst in a vacant unit can go undetected for days. Deploying wireless sensors connected to a central building gateway ensures that vacant units remain monitored 24/7 without requiring manual daily inspections by maintenance staff.

🛡️ Advanced AI & Predictive Analytics in Water Detection

The future of water safety lies in predictive maintenance. Modern smart building networks analyze data from both flow meters and localized leak sensors. By comparing water flow patterns with sensor data, AI algorithms can distinguish between normal water usage (like a shower) and an abnormal continuous flow indicative of a hidden slab leak or a burst pipe, automatically flagging the anomaly for inspection.
